Output f65229874df14ecffd7e264ea9a100e3ac89ff671664c397859fa3aaab3b2931:92

value
24086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 607c31b41869da86141a891cbb72779e5fa85ae4 OP_EQUAL
address
3AVBa7wvryFv96uCxaHAzTMo8wg9vuD79h
transaction
f65229874df14ecffd7e264ea9a100e3ac89ff671664c397859fa3aaab3b2931
confirmations
471
spent
true